Understanding Acoustic Vents: Definition and Mechanism of Action

Acoustic vents serve a unique purpose in soundproofing. They allow airflow while minimizing noise transmission. These vents utilize specialized materials to absorb and dampen sound. Research indicates that spaces fitted with acoustic vents can reduce sound levels by up to 30%. This is significant in environments like offices or studios, where clarity is crucial.

The mechanism behind acoustic vents is intriguing. They often incorporate acoustic foam or similar materials. These materials trap sound waves, preventing them from bouncing around a room. Some studies show that effective sound isolation can improve productivity by 15% in workplaces. A quieter environment allows for better focus and creativity.

However, not all acoustic vents are designed equally. Their effectiveness can vary based on installation and placement. Users need to consider room size and intended use when selecting a vent. Mistakes in choosing the wrong type can lead to inadequate noise reduction. It’s essential to be mindful of the specific acoustic needs of each space. This highlights the importance of careful planning and design in achieving optimal soundproofing.

Reduction of Noise Pollution: Statistical Impact on Urban Environments

Noise pollution has increasingly become a pressing concern in urban environments. Data from the World Health Organization shows that over 1.1 billion people are at risk of hearing loss due to excessive noise exposure. Acoustic vents present a unique solution to mitigate this issue. These vents can effectively reduce sound transmission, making spaces more serene and comfortable.

In bustling cities, studies indicate that noise can be reduced by up to 10 decibels with proper acoustic vent installation. This decrease can significantly lower stress levels for residents. An environment with reduced noise fosters better mental health and increases focus, especially in workplaces. Research conducted by the Environmental Protection Agency states that persistent noise levels above 70 decibels can lead to serious health problems, including hypertension and cardiovascular issues.

While the advantages are clear, not all installations guarantee results. Misalignment or improper sealing may result in insufficient soundproofing. It’s essential to consider the quality of materials used in acoustic vents. Attention to detail during the installation process is crucial for maximizing noise reduction. Even small gaps can compromise effectiveness. Therefore, careful evaluation and professional guidance become essential in achieving the desired acoustic environment.
